Listed below are the best beaches and waterfront escapes near Payne, Ohio.


1. Wayne Lakes Park Splash into summer at Algonquin Lake's sandy beach, perfect for swimming, sunbathing, and family picnics. This laidback spot offers affordable admission, peaceful views, and convenient amenities for a classic beach day.


2. Headlands Beach State Park Unwind on Ohio's biggest natural sand beach, famed for its vast shoreline, dramatic sunsets, and rare sand dune habitats. Visitors enjoy swimming, beachcombing for glass, wildlife spotting, and trails with lake views.


3. East Harbor State Park Sunbathe and swim at this lively Lake Erie destination, with a wide sandy beach, nature trails, and picnic sites. The park is a hit for wildlife observation, paddle sports, and birding along scenic dunes.


4. Cedar Point Beach Relax on the broad, golden sands next to thrilling roller coasters and Lake Erie's waves. This public beach draws visitors for sunbathing, swimming, volleyball, and energetic boardwalk fun.


5. Kelleys Island State Park Enjoy tranquil swimming and sunbathing on the island's sandy lakeshore, surrounded by limestone cliffs and wooded trails. The setting is ideal for kayaking, beach picnics, and spotting migratory birds.



6. Lake Front Park Take in the calm waters and clean sand at this welcoming community beach, great for swimming, sunbathing, and lakeside strolls. Ample space and easy access make it a favorite for families and outdoor enthusiasts.


7. Maumee Bay State Park Explore two public beaches on Lake Erie and an inland lake, offering prime swimming, sunbathing, and wildlife viewing. The park's boardwalks, trails, and picnic areas create a full day of beach recreation.


8. Old Field Beach at Indian Lake State Park Dive into clear waters and stretch out on sandy shoreline—ideal for swimming, sunbathing, and lakeside games. Nearby picnic tables, concessions, and scenic views make it a top spot for summer relaxing.


9. Delaware State Park Beach Enjoy the spacious beach along Delaware Lake for swimming, sunbathing, and fishing in a tranquil setting. The park's shady groves and wildlife-rich waters make it a favorite for picnics and nature walks.


10. Grand Lake St. Marys State Park Step onto sandy beaches and splash in Grand Lake, a classic spot for swimming, beach volleyball, and boating. The park's open spaces and wildlife habitats offer a relaxing escape for families and outdoor lovers.
